Seniors Deanna Henriott and Becky Vyzas Lead Tampa to Victory
MELBOURNE, Fla. - The No. 20 University of Tampa (19-3, 4-0 SSC) softball team claimed a 1-0 win over Florida Tech (11-15, 1-6 SSC) in the Sunshine State Conference series opener at Nancy Bottge Field.
The game was a pitching battle until UT catcher Becky Vyzas put the Spartans on top 1-0 with a two-out RBI double in the top of the sixth inning. The senior drove home freshman shortstop Kayleen Boatwright, who reached on a walk.
After hitting two home runs in the Feb. 11 victory over Florida Tech, Vyzas led Leslie Kanter's Spartans with two hits and an RBI.
Deanna Henriott (11-2) struck out 12 Panthers while only allowing one hit. UT's all-time winningest pitcher is also approaching the 1,000 strikeout milestone and now stands at 940 as the program's leader in career strikeouts. It was also the sixth shutout of the season for UT's ace. Taylor Smith (4-7) took the loss for FIT.
Tampa now has 30.1 scoreless innings as a team, dating back to Feb. 25 versus Palm Beach Atlantic. The UT school record for consecutive scoreless innings is 43.0 from the 2007 season.
